MedHelp

MedHelp is a healthcare institution located at 1 West Lakeshore Drive in Birmingham, Alabama, United States. They offer Urgent Care and Primary Care services, including rapid COVID-19 testing. Patients can receive superior care from board-certified physicians without the need for an appointment, with walk-ins welcome. MedHelp also provides Family Medicine, Women's Health, Wellness Therapies, Long COVID care, and more. They offer in-clinic follow-up care for COVID-positive patients, COVID-19 antibody testing, and curbside testing. Telehealth consultations are available for convenience, and MedHelp Rx is a full-service pharmacy located on-site. Additionally, they offer clinical trials, dermatology, sports medicine, employee health services, lab testing, chronic disease management, and more. With five locations in the Birmingham area, MedHelp is committed to providing compassionate and affordable healthcare to all patients.

"I began seeing Summer Powers, Nurse Practitioner at MedHelp Lakeshore after experiencing Long COVID systems for three years. My general practitioner and specialists I had seen during that time all admitted that they did not know what was causing my health issues; extreme fatigue, lack of focus and unable to concentrate or remember, body aches and pain, shortness of breathe, anxiety, but they tried to treat the symptoms. I was misdiagnosed as having MS. I am so thankful that a family member told me about the clinic, it has been a blessing! My experience with front office staff as well as the nurses has been the most pleasant I think I’ve ever had in a medical environment. Calls are answered and/or responded to promptly and courteously. When I arrive for my appointments my wait is never long. The communication and education I receive from Summer Powers is phenomenal. It’s very reassuring to understand what is going on with my health. The desire of everyone in the clinic to assist in my recovery is very evident. For this I am so grateful."

"Literal mixed bag. When I can actually get in, they are usually really great. They are respectful, through, and actually make sure you understand how to handle your treatment. However, I've been finding out that their hours are not correct. Everything says that they close at 8, but they lock their doors at 7. Even their physical building says "closes at 8". I get off work at 7 so I have been praying that they will keep their doors open until 8. But this has not been the case in the past few months. Maybe update your hours online and at your facility so people can make appropriate plans?? It would be great if anything ever answered the phone, but that's also not something that happens... If you can get seen, it's a great place to go. But go in the middle of day to avoid any issues."
